SAVE THE TOBACCO BARN
Over the years, weather damage has taken its toll and the structure, built in 1900, has slowly started the process of falling off its foundation - a scene that has, unfortunately, become all too familiar across the state for similar barns. Because the tobacco barn is over 122 years old, the process for correcting the damage is going to be intricate.
Community support is needed to help preserve the Tobacco Barn through financial donations.
